First and foremost, let's talk about your internet connection – this is the backbone of all streaming endeavors. A stable and fast internet connection is non-negotiable. If you're on Wi-Fi, try to be as close to your router as possible, or better yet, if you're watching on a laptop or desktop, consider a wired Ethernet connection. This eliminates potential wireless interference and provides the most consistent speed. For mobile data, make sure you have a strong signal (4G/5G) and that you haven't hit any data caps that might throttle your speed. A good rule of thumb for HD streaming is at least 5-10 Mbps download speed, but more is always better for ultra-smooth TV One viewing. Secondly, device compatibility and optimization play a big role. Make sure the device you're using – whether it's your smartphone, tablet, or computer – meets the minimum requirements for the TV One app or website. Keep your operating system and the TV One app itself updated to their latest versions. Developers constantly release updates that improve performance, fix bugs, and enhance security. Also, close any unnecessary background applications or browser tabs that might be hogging your device's resources or internet bandwidth. This frees up processing power and ensures that all resources are dedicated to your TV One stream. Thirdly, consider your browser choice if you're streaming via the website. Some browsers are more efficient at handling video playback than others. Chrome, Firefox, and Edge are generally good choices, but occasionally, switching to a different browser can resolve unexpected issues. Also, make sure your browser is updated and that any ad-blockers aren't inadvertently interfering with the video player. You might need to temporarily disable them for the TV One website if you encounter problems. Fourth, picture quality settings are your friend. Most TV One streaming platforms (website or app) will offer options to adjust the video quality, usually represented by resolution (e.g., 480p, 720p, 1080p). If your internet connection is struggling, don't be afraid to temporarily drop the quality down a notch. It's better to watch a slightly lower resolution stream without buffering than a high-resolution one that constantly freezes. Conversely, if you've got blazing-fast internet, crank it up to the highest setting for that crisp, clear TV One experience. Finally, monitor your data usage, especially if you're streaming on mobile data. Live streaming can consume a significant amount of data, so keep an eye on your plan's limits to avoid unexpected charges or throttled speeds. Some TV One apps might even have a data saver mode, which is super handy for extending your viewing time without burning through your allowance too quickly. The most frequent culprit behind a choppy or freezing stream is almost always your internet connection. First, do a quick check: Is your Wi-Fi connected? Is your mobile data turned on? Try running a speed test (just search "internet speed test" on Google) to see if you're getting adequate download speeds. Remember, for HD streaming, you're looking for at least 5-10 Mbps. If your speed is low, try restarting your router/modem; unplug it for 30 seconds, then plug it back in. Also, if you're on Wi-Fi, try moving closer to your router or switching to a less congested Wi-Fi channel if you know how. If your internet is fine but the stream is still buffering, try refreshing the webpage or restarting the TV One app. Sometimes, a quick reset is all it takes to clear up temporary glitches. If the app is crashing or freezing, try force-closing it (swipe up from the bottom on iOS, or go to recent apps and swipe away on Android) and then reopening it. If that doesn't work, consider clearing the app's cache (in Android settings under Apps -> TV One -> Storage) or, as a last resort, uninstalling and reinstalling the app. This often resolves corrupted data issues. Another common headache is login problems. If you can't log into your TV One account on the website or app, first double-check your username and password. Seriously, a typo is easier to make than you think! If you’re sure they're correct, try the "Forgot Password" option to reset it. Also, ensure your account isn't locked or suspended for any reason (though this is less common). Sometimes, using a different browser for the website or ensuring the app is updated can also fix login glitches. Geo-restrictions can also pop up. If you're traveling outside your home country, you might find that TV One's live stream is unavailable due to content licensing agreements. This is often indicated by a message like "This content is not available in your region." While some people use Virtual Private Networks (VPNs) to bypass these restrictions, be aware that this can sometimes violate terms of service, and not all VPNs work reliably with streaming services. If you encounter this, it's usually an unavoidable restriction unless TV One offers an international version of its service. Lastly, if all else fails, check TV One's official social media channels or their website's support section. They often post updates about widespread service outages or known technical issues. Sometimes, the problem isn't on your end at all, but a server issue on their side, and knowing that can save you a lot of personal troubleshooting frustration.
